Report: Kesha Suing Dr. Luke After Alleged Decade Of Sexual, Physical & Emotional Abuse

Robbie Daw | October 14, 2014 10:23 am

Together they have collaborated on four chart-topping singles and multiple other Top 10 hits over the past six years, but today brought news of an absolute bombshell regarding the professional relationship between artist Kesha and her producer Dr. Luke.

In a lawsuit reported to have been filed by the pop singer to extricate her from her contract with Luke, there are allegations that the producer “sexually, physically, verbally and emotionally abused” Kesha for 10 years, according to TMZ.

The site claims to have obtained a copy of the suit, and notes, “Kesha claims Dr. Luke was abusive towards her almost from the get-go — when she signed on with him at 18 — and made repeated sexual advances toward her. She claims he would force her to use drugs and alcohol to remove her defenses.”

UPDATE: According to TMZ, Dr. Luke has now filed suit against the singer, claiming that she planned to extort the producer by threatening to spread lies about him to a “Free Kesha” website. His lawyer, Christine Lepera, told TMZ that Kesha’s allegations are a part of “a campaign of publishing outrageous and untrue statements.”

Kesha Sebert, 27, first came into the public’s eye (and ear) via her uncredited vocals on Flo Rida‘s 2009 single “Right Round,” which topped the Billboard Hot 100. Dr. Luke, 41 (whose real name is Lukasz Gottwad), co-produced that song, as well as Kesha’s subsequent hits like “Tik Tok,” “We R Who We R” and, most recently, “Timber,” a vocal collaboration with Pitbull that reached #1 earlier this year.

While “Timber” was riding high in January, however, things were not so fantastic behind the scenes. Kesha checked into Illinois rehab facility Timberline Knolls Residential Treatment Center, citing an eating disorder. The singer’s mother, Pebe Sebert, claimed Dr. Luke was partly to blame for the disorder, given that he was said to have been emotionally abusive to Kesha over the years. TMZ posted in January that Luke had referred to the singer as looking “like a fucking refrigerator” during a 2012 video shoot.

Now TMZ is reporting the following:

[Kesha] claims [Dr. Luke] would force her to use drugs and alcohol to remove her defenses.

In one instance, Kesha claims he forced her to snort something before getting on a plane … and during the trip he forced himself on her while she was drugged.

On another occasion, Kesha claims after forcing her to drink with him, Dr. Luke gave her what he called “sober pills.” Kesha claims she woke up the following afternoon, naked in Dr. Luke’s bed, sore, sick … and with no memory of how she got there.

Kesha also says there was physical abuse … once she says he attacked her at his Malibu house where he was “violently thrashing his arms at her.” She says she escaped and ran barefoot down PCH and hid in the mountains.

The lawsuit has been filed as a means to remove Kesha from her contract with Dr. Luke, according to TMZ.

“This lawsuit is a wholehearted effort by Kesha to regain control of her music career and her personal freedom after suffering for ten years as a victim of mental manipulation, emotional abuse and an instance of sexual assault at the hands of Dr. Luke,” Kesha’s lawyer, Mark Geragos, tells the site.
